Rock Island sits along the Columbia River in central Washington, a stretch of the state where the landscape shifts dramatically from the Cascade foothills into open basalt plateau country. The region is high desert in character — dry, sun-baked summers, wide skies, and the kind of terrain where golf courses feel genuinely earned against the surrounding sage and scrubland. The Columbia runs through here with real authority, and the town of Rock Island itself is a small, working community shaped largely by the river and the hydroelectric history of the mid-Columbia basin.

| Tee | Yards | Rating | Slope | Par |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Black · men | 7,174 | 74.1 | 127 | 72 |
| Blue · men | 6,651 | 71.7 | 122 | 72 |
| White · men | 6,164 | 69.2 | 116 | 72 |
| White · women | 6,164 | 75 | 128 | 72 |
| Silver · men | 5,480 | 66.8 | 107 | 72 |
| Silver · women | 5,480 | 71.4 | 120 | 72 |
| Gold · men | 4,886 | 63.7 | 102 | 72 |
| Gold · women | 4,886 | 67.9 | 112 | 72 |
